Official Search Methodology

The primary resource for locating an inmate is the Florida Department of Corrections inmate search portal. This tool allows users to query the system using specific identifiers such as the last name, first name, or unique DC Number assigned to the individual. The interface is designed for efficiency, allowing users to filter results quickly. For those without internet access, alternative methods exist, though they may require more time and direct communication with the facility or regional office.

Utilizing the Inmate Database

Navigate to the official Florida Department of Corrections website.

Locate the "Inmate Search" or "Offender Search" link, typically found on the main page.

Enter the full name or identification number of the person you are inquiring about.

Review the results carefully, verifying details such as date of birth and incarceration status.

Information Available to the Public

Typically, the published list includes essential details that do not compromise security or personal privacy. These data points serve to confirm custody status and general location. The information is updated regularly to reflect the current population. Individuals seeking to verify a specific person's status will find the search function intuitive and straightforward.

Field
Description
Name
Legal first and last name of the inmate
DC Number
Unique state identification number
Location
Current housing facility or status
Charges
General offense classification
Status
Active, released, or transferred
